Adoption of AI Tools Among Faculty Members in Higher Education

Nowadays Artificial Intelligence (AI) has emerged as a transformative technology in the education sector, offering innovative solutions for teaching, learning, assessment, and research. The adoption of AI tools among faculty members has significantly increased in recent years due to their ability to enhance productivity, personalize learning experiences, and improve academic outcomes. This study examines the adoption of AI tools among faculty members in higher education institutions. The research focuses on understanding the level of awareness, usage patterns, satisfaction levels, and perceived benefits and challenges associated with AI tools. Data were collected from 86 faculty members using a structured questionnaire. The findings indicate that AI tools are widely used for content preparation, research assistance, and student engagement. While faculty members recognize the advantages of AI in improving teaching effectiveness, concerns regarding accuracy, ethical issues, and overdependence remain significant challenges.
